Understanding Personalized Medicine

The concept of personalized medicine revolves around tailoring medical treatments and interventions to individual patients based on their unique characteristics. It takes into account factors such as a person’s genetic makeup, lifestyle, and environmental factors to determine the most effective course of action.

One of the key aspects of personalized medicine is the ability to identify genetic variations that may predispose individuals to certain diseases. By analyzing an individual’s DNA, healthcare professionals can gain valuable insights into their risk profile and develop personalized prevention strategies.

The Concept of Personalized Medicine

Personalized medicine fundamentally shifts the focus from a one-size-fits-all approach to a more targeted and individualized approach. Instead of relying solely on population-based guidelines, healthcare providers can now make informed decisions that are specifically tailored to each patient’s needs.

This approach recognizes that not all patients will respond to treatments in the same way. What may work for one individual might not be effective for another. By understanding the unique characteristics of each patient, personalized medicine aims to maximize the chances of positive outcomes while minimizing adverse effects.

The Importance of Personalized Medicine

Personalized medicine holds great promise for improving patient outcomes and transforming the healthcare landscape. By optimizing the selection of treatments and interventions, healthcare providers can ensure that patients receive the most effective and efficient care possible.

Furthermore, personalized medicine has the potential to reduce healthcare costs in the long run. By tailoring treatments to individual patients, unnecessary procedures and medications can be avoided, saving both time and resources.

In addition to improving patient care and reducing costs, personalized medicine also plays a vital role in the prevention and early detection of diseases. By identifying individuals with a higher risk of developing certain conditions, healthcare professionals can intervene early to prevent or mitigate the impact of these diseases.

The Intersection of Medicine and Technology

Technology has transformed the healthcare industry, enabling the collection and analysis of large datasets that were previously unimaginable. With the advent of electronic health records and wearable devices, healthcare providers now have access to an unprecedented amount of patient information.

This wealth of data provides valuable insights into patient behavior, treatment outcomes, and disease progression. By leveraging this information, healthcare professionals can make more precise and accurate predictions about an individual’s health and tailor treatments accordingly.

Technological Innovations Driving Personalized Medicine

Various technological innovations have played a crucial role in advancing personalized medicine. One notable example is the development of next-generation sequencing (NGS) technologies, which enable rapid and cost-effective analysis of an individual’s entire genome.

NGS has revolutionized genetic testing by allowing healthcare professionals to identify genetic variations more efficiently. This has not only enhanced our understanding of the genetic basis of diseases but has also paved the way for personalized treatment approaches. Additionally, clinical genomics plays a crucial role in utilizing this genetic data to develop precise, individualized treatment strategies, further advancing the effectiveness of personalized medicine.

In addition to NGS, other technological advancements, such as art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ms, have also contributed to the growth of personalized medicine. These tools can analyze large datasets and identify patterns that may not be apparent to the human eye, enabling more accurate diagnoses and treatment recommendations.

Challenges and Opportunities in Personalized Medicine

While personalized medicine offers immense opportunities, it also presents its fair share of challenges. Healthcare professionals must navigate these obstacles to harness the full potential of personalized medicine.

Navigating the Challenges

One of the main challenges in personalized medicine is the ethical and legal implications of genetic testing and access to personal health data. Striking a balance between privacy concerns and the potential benefits of sharing data is crucial to ensure trust and maintain the integrity of personalized medicine.

Another challenge lies in the interpretation of genetic data and translating it into actionable insights. The complexity of the human genome and the interplay between genes and the environment make analysis and interpretation a challenging task.

Harnessing the Opportunities

Despite the challenges, personalized medicine presents abundant opportunities for improving patient care and advancing medical knowledge. Collaborative efforts between healthcare professionals, researchers, and technological innovators are vital in harnessing these opportunities.

Investments in research and development are crucial to furthering our understanding of the human genome and developing innovative technologies that support personalized medicine. Moreover, educational initiatives can equip healthcare professionals with the necessary skills to leverage advanced technologies and incorporate personalized medicine into their practice.
